We provide IT Staff Augmentation Services!

Full Stack Developer Resume

0/5 (Submit Your Rating)

San Jose, CaliforniA

SUMMARY

  • 6 years’ work experience as a Web Developer in developing web applications and web services using JAVA and J2EE technologies.
  • Worked extensively on Javascript and Jquery in developing web applications.
  • Has done server side scripting using Node JS to develop the applications, which are data intensive real time applications that run on distributed devices.
  • Developed Single page web applications using Angular JS for websites requiring data - rich and instant feedback on interaction.
  • Used React JS as the default template engine in developing the web applications. Mapped app’s visual state in the browser to URLs using React - router to support bookmarking.
  • Experience in working wif projects dealing wif Mongo DB and MySQL.
  • Implemented SOAP services to access the services written in C++ on a Java platform.
  • Created RESTful APIs in Java environment using JAX-RS and Node Js using express framework.
  • Conducted tests for applications developed in Angular JS using Karma and Jasmine frameworks.
  • Worked on Jenkins to achieve continuous integration and build automation in AGILE projects. Thus, found errors early in the process.
  • Used Maven for build management and to handle dependency.
  • Worked in projects, which follows Waterfall and AGILE (SCRUM) methodologies.
  • Developed test scripts in Selenium WebDriver to do Unit testing and functional testing for web applications.
  • Expertise in integrating visualization tools like D3 JS and Apache POI API’s.
  • Maintained project code repository using GIT, SVN and IBM ClearCaSe.
  • Worked closely wif development teams and cross-functional teams like QA teams to successfully resolve the issues.
  • Has done root cause analysis along wif the Business and QA team.
  • Well versed in analysis of requirements, requirement gathering and Impact analysis.
  • Ability to communicate very effectively wif the co-workers and cross-functional teams.

TECHNICAL SKILLS

Languages\Databases\: Core Java, Javascript, MATLAB, SQL\MongoDB, MySQL, Oracle \

Front End Technologies\Tools\: AngularJS, React JS, Node JS, Express, \Maven, Jenkins, Selenium RC, Selenium 2.0, \ Javascript, Jquery, AJAX, HTML5, CSS3, \GIT, Karma\ Bootstrap3, D3.Js\

Version Control\IDE’s\: GIT, SVN, ClearCase.\Eclipse, WebStorm, Sublime Text Editor, \

Creative Tools\OS\: Adobe Dreamweaver, Adobe Photoshop, \Windows, UNIX, Mac\Adobe Lightroom\

PROFESSIONAL EXPERIENCE

Confidential, San Jose, California

Full Stack Developer

Responsibilities:

  • Contributed towards creating UX user stories of the web pages along wif product team.
  • Designed the webpages using HTML5, CSS3 and Bootstrap technologies.
  • Client side scripting has been done using Angular JS to add the interactivity to the pages and to implement Single page application for the account over view module.
  • Created web pages and Reusable components using React JS.
  • Business logic has been implemented using Node JS at the server side.
  • User authentication has been implemented by using Passport module in Express framework.
  • Worked on MongoDB along wif mongoose to store the consumer’s data into the database.
  • Created RESTful APIs in Node JS using Express framework and consumed them from Angular JS.
  • Unit test case scripts has been developed using Jasmine framework and ran the test cases using karma tool.
  • The test results are document and reported using D3.Js framework to build the data visualization.
  • Conducted Smoke test to minimize the bugs as much as possible in build delivered to QA team.
  • Worked in an AGILE methodology along wif cross-functional teams and cross vertical teams.
  • Used Rally for Agile Project management to look up the user stories, defects and any sprint updates.
  • Setup the testing environment using VM stages wif all the test data. Deployed the builds to test using automated Jenkins Jobs.
  • Integrated the code wif D3 JS to generate report for analytical analysis.
  • Successfully used GIT as a code repository for the project.

Environment: Angular JS 1.4, Node JS, BootStrap3, HTML5, CSS3, MongoDB, Oracle, JAVA (1.7), Express, Rally, GIT, RESTful APIs, D3.JS, Selenium 2.0, TestNG, Jenkins, JIRA, Eclipse (Mars-4.5.0), Sublime Text (2.0)

Confidential, St Louis, Missouri

Software Developer

Responsibilities:

  • Involved in development and testing of Confidential Send APIs services to initiate the fund transfer.
  • Developed Card Eligibility API to determine if a receiving card is eligible for MoneySend and provides information about sending and receiving cards such as issuer, brand product type country and currency.
  • Worked on developing Card Mapping API to provide interoperability between receiving institutions.
  • Developed responsive and cross browser MasterSend card web pages using Angular JS, JQuery, HTML5, CSS5 and bootstrap.
  • Worked wif the UX team in an AGILE environment to create the HTML and CSS templates.
  • Credit card/debit card information has been retrieved from the database using RESTful web services.
  • Optimized images to display them on the marketing pages using Adobe Photoshop.
  • Created web application prototypes to paint a vision for front - end user interaction wif useful static information using custom modules in Angular JS.
  • Written code to retrieve the data from web services by making a call to the respective web services using JQuery/AJAX.
  • Created automated builds and test processes using Jenkins Jobs to achieve continuous Integration.
  • Developed automated test scripts using Jasmine and executed the test scripts across all browsers using karma tool.
  • Executed the test scripts using Selenium Webdriver to test the unit cases. Selenium GRID has been used to run the test cases across cross platforms and cross browsers.
  • Used GIT for maintaining the version control.

Environment: Angular JS 1.4, BootStrap3, HTML5, CSS3, Java (1.7), Spring MVC, Hibernate, Oracle 11g, RESTful APIs, GIT, Jenkins, JIRA

Confidential, Foster City, CA

Software Developer

Responsibilities:

  • Requirement analysis, development and Implementation of Technical design document using Java and J2EE technologies.
  • Developed the Replace Cards and Manage Customer APIs using spring framework and JAX RS
  • Experience in working wif RDBMS using JDBC connection management for Oracle database.
  • Worked on JASON and XML to send and receive data to and from the APIs.
  • Has done unit testing using selenium web driver using TESTNG framework.
  • Generated unit testing reports for analysis and visualization using Apache POI.

Environment: Java, Spring MVC, XML, JASON, JDBC, Oracle 11g, SOAP, RESTful APIs, GIT, Jenkins, IBM ClearQuest, Oracle SQL developer, Eclipse

Confidential, San Jose California

Software Developer

Responsibilities:

  • Involved in discussions wif Business team on requirement gathering and designing Technical documents.
  • Designed and developed the user friendly UI screens using HTML, CSS, JavaScript framework wif custom data layer that used for data requests and application events.
  • Developed code to call the web service/APIs to fetch the data and populate on the UI using JQuery/AJAX.
  • Extensively involved in design discussions and user experience sessions to provide inputs on the layout and UX.
  • Actively involved in SDLC waterfall model to design, develop, test and deploy.
  • Maintained the project code repository using SVN version control tool.

Environment: Java, Javascript, JQuery, XML, JASON, JDBC, MySQL, SOAP APIs, IBM ClearQuest, IBM ClearCase, Oracle 10g, Oracle SQL Developer Eclipse (v 3.5.1)

Confidential

Responsibilities:

  • Developed web pages for billing systems using HTML and CSS, JQuery.
  • Has written application level code to add functionality to perform client side validation using Javascript and JQuery.
  • Translating market and product requirements into UI designs in the form of conceptual models, wire frames and prototypes.
  • Worked in waterfall model of the Software development lifecycle.

Environment: Java, Javascript, JQuery, HTML 4, CSS2, XML, JASON, JDBC, MySQL, IBM ClearQuest, IBM ClearCase, Oracle 10g, Oracle SQL Developer

We'd love your feedback!